I am in Indiana.

So a few months ago, I started fixing my credit and paying things that I owed. Well, on my credit was a collection account from my doctor office. I contacted them and they gave me a collection agency's information to pay through them.

I called the collection agency and they said they had 5 accounts totaling in $700 almost $800, they wanted a full payment right then. Absolutely not. I asked for the account numbers and the balances and that I'd pay through their online payment system so that I could print some kind of proof that I paid.

So January 22nd, I make my first payment of these 5 bills. I give the credit card information, it denies it for whatever reason. I printed that off and then did it by check with routing number and account number it says it is approved. They NEVER take the money. I get paid again and pay on another account they claim I have, I pay the same way as the last time and again they don't take the money. Mind you I am paying these payments in full for the accounts they have. Once I pay they send a receipt, yet they never took the money ever.

Fast forward to April 11, I make the last payment on the biggest bill. EVERY bill was paid in full.
Now they are contacting me to pay the bill and I am so confused. I gave them the opportunity starting in Jan to take the money out of my account and they never did. Technically, I have receipts showing that I did pay. And the account I used is long gone since that is the reason I had the account in the first place.

What should be my next step?

Your "receipt" from their computerized system will be of no value without corresponding evidence of payment(s). Anyone can throw some formatted text together and slap it on a sheet of paper and claim that they made all 72 car payments.

Not to mention that, morally, you know what's right and what's wrong here.
